Serial EEPROM Series Standard EEPROM
Microwire BUS EEPROM(3-Wire)
BR93Lxx-W
●General Description
BR93Lxx-W is serial EEPROM of serial 3-line interface method
●Features
„ 3-line communications of chip select, serial clock, serial data
input / output (the case where input and output are shared)
„ Actions available at high speed 2MHz clock(2.5V to 5.5V)
„ Speed write available (write time 5ms max.)
„ Same package and pin layout from 1Kbit to 16Kbit
„ 1.8V to 5.5V single power source action
„ Address auto increment function at read action
„ Write mistake prevention function
¾ Write prohibition at power on
¾ Write prohibition by command code
¾ Write mistake prevention function at low voltage
„ Program cycle auto delete and auto end function
„ Program condition display by READY / BUSY
„ Low current consumption
¾ At write action (at 5V) : 1.2mA (Typ.)
¾ At read action (at 5V) : 0.3mA (Typ.)
¾ At standby action (at 5V) : 0.1μA (Typ.)(CMOS input)
„ TTL compatible( input / outputs)
„ Data retention for 40 years
„ Endurance up to 1,000,000 times
„ Data at shipment all addresses FFFFh
